ssm,mysql,用户账号密码的修改
时间: 2024-01-03 08:05:35 浏览: 30
您好,如果您要使用SSM框架和MySQL数据库进行用户账号密码的修改,以下是一些基本步骤:
1. 在MyBatis中编写更新用户信息的SQL语句,并将其映射为一个UserMapper接口中的update方法。
2. 在Spring MVC中创建一个UserController类,该类包含一个update方法,该方法接收一个HttpServletRequest对象和一个HttpServletResponse对象作为参数。
3. 在update方法中,获取需要修改的用户的用户名和新密码参数,并调用UserMapper接口中的update方法进行用户信息的更新。
4. 如果更新成功,则返回成功信息并跳转到主页。
5. 如果更新失败,则返回失败信息并停留在修改页面。
以上是一个简单的SSM框架中用户账号密码修改的示例,其中包含了MyBatis、Spring MVC和Spring框架的使用。当然,具体的实现方式会根据您的需求和具体情况而有所不同。如果您有更具体的问题,请随时提出,我会尽力帮助您。
相关问题
以MySQL的基于ssm的农产品交易系统功能测试
好的,针对基于MySQL的基于SSM的农产品交易系统,我可以提供以下的功能测试点:
1. 用户注册:测试用户注册功能是否正常,包括输入验证、账号密码的保存等;
2. 用户登录:测试用户登录功能是否正常,包括输入验证、账号密码的验证等;
3. 农产品展示:测试系统是否能够正常展示在售的农产品信息,包括商品名称、价格、库存等;
4. 农产品搜索:测试系统是否能够根据关键词进行农产品搜索,包括搜索结果的准确性、搜索速度等;
5. 购物车功能:测试购物车功能是否正常,包括添加商品、删除商品、修改商品数量等;
6. 订单生成:测试订单生成功能是否正常,包括生成订单的完整性、订单状态的更新等;
7. 支付功能:测试支付功能是否正常,包括支付方式的选择、支付金额的准确性、支付成功后订单状态的更新等;
8. 物流跟踪:测试物流跟踪功能是否正常,包括订单状态的更新、物流信息的展示等;
9. 评价功能:测试评价功能是否正常,包括评价的准确性、评价的展示等;
10. 数据库备份与恢复:测试数据库备份和恢复功能是否正常,包括备份的完整性、恢复的准确性等。
以上是我提供的一些基本的功能测试点,具体的测试用例和测试步骤可以根据实际情况进一步细化和完善。
基于ssm框架的毕业设计
基于SSM框架的毕业设计可以选择一些比较热门的主题,如在线教育、酒店管理、电商平台等。
以下是一个基于SSM框架的毕业设计的示例:
主题:在线教育平台
技术栈:Spring + Spring MVC + MyBatis + Bootstrap + MySQL
功能模块:
1. 用户注册登录模块:用户可以注册账号并登录,进行个人信息管理、密码修改等操作。
2. 课程管理模块:管理员可以发布、修改、删除课程信息,用户可以浏览、购买课程。
3. 订单管理模块:用户可以创建订单、查看订单状态、评价订单等操作。
4. 支付模块:用户可以选择支付方式,完成订单支付。
5. 评价模块:用户可以对课程、教师、订单进行评价。
6. 消息通知模块:系统可以向用户发送课程更新、订单状态等消息通知。
7. 数据统计模块:管理员可以查看网站用户、课程、订单等数据统计信息。
总结:
以上是一个基于SSM框架的毕业设计的简单示例,可以根据实际情况进行功能模块的扩展。在实现过程中,需要注意数据表设计、业务逻辑处理、前后端交互等方面的细节。同时,建议使用Git等版本控制工具进行代码管理,以便于团队协作和代码维护。